The Sound Devices A20-Nexus is an 8- to 16-channel True Diversity receiver with SpectraBand technology. This half-rack unit integrates advanced features such as NexLink remote control, real-time spectrum analysis, Dante audio-over-IP, full touch operation, and GainForward architecture. The Nexus offers comprehensive connectivity, including dual DB25, optical SFP, and BNC timecode input. It supports PoE+, DC input, mains power (via adapter), or direct connection to a Sound Devices 8-Series recorder via A20-QuickDock. The 6.2" OLED touchscreen and browser-based Web App ensure efficient control.
Main Features
- 8-channel True Diversity receiver in ½ rack size (8.0" × 6.6" × 1.6")
- Expandable to 12 or 16 channels via software license
- SpectraBand tuning range: 470–1525 MHz
- Supports Dante, PoE+, and long-range NexLink control
- 6.2" OLED touchscreen for setup and monitoring
- GainForward: adjust gain at receiver or mixer
- 100% digital modulation with 10 Hz – 20 kHz audio bandwidth
- Dual DB25 outputs for analog, AES, and Dante
- SFP slot for optical networking
- BNC timecode input for syncing transmitters over NexLink
Specifications
- Size: 8.0 × 6.6 × 1.6 inches
- Weight: approx. 1.4 kg
- Frequency range: 470 MHz – 1525 MHz (SpectraBand)
- Outputs: 16x Dante, 16x analog/AES via DB25
- Power: PoE+, 10–18 VDC, 100–240 VAC (with adapter), 8-Series Dock
- Display: 6.2" OLED touchscreen
- Control: Web App via browser
- Network: Ethernet RJ45 and SFP (optional)
